USB3.0 IS SPREADING BUT MAYBE ALREADY OBSOLETE - AT BIRTH!!

Posted: 29 Aug 2010 06:03 PM PDT

Your Move, Intel:

Intel is a member of the USB working group but has been rather quiet about
USB 3.0. In late 2009, Nvidia (no friend of Intel), told anyone who would
listen that Intel would not put USB 3.0 support in its chipsets until 2011,
and Intel chipsets are dominant in the x86 market (unless you go for AMD).

Later, that rumored delay date was pushed out to 2012. The motherboards and

Help with understanding log entry

Posted: 29 Aug 2010 02:50 AM PDT

First off, how can you just "write a rule to permit it" if you do not
understand what it is?
Your router is sending SNMP traps. Go to its setup and disable it. If
you plan on using SNMP monitoring, then configure a specific IP address,
not the entire subnet.
